40KN Hydraulic Cable Puller for Overhead Stringing Projects
Overview
The 40KN Hydraulic Cable Puller is a powerful and efficient tool designed specifically for overhead stringing projects in utility and construction industries. This high-performance equipment is essential for installing heavy-duty cables over long distances in power transmission systems, telecommunications, and infrastructure projects.
Definition
A Hydraulic Cable Puller is a device powered by hydraulic force used to pull cables through ducts or over distances during cable installation. The 40KN model provides up to 40 kN of pulling force, making it suitable for large, heavy-duty cables in overhead stringing applications.

Technical Specifications
Performance Parameters
Max intermittent pulling force 40KN
Max continuous pulling force 30KN
Corresponding speed 2.5km/h
Max continuous pulling speed 5km/h
Corresponding pulling force 20KN
Structure Parameters
Puller wheel diameter 400mm
Groove number 7
Max diameter of applicable steel wire rope 16mm
Diesel Power 77KW
Overall dimensions (L*W*H) 3600*2600*2200mm
Total weight 3500kg
Main Configurations
Engine Cummins
Main pump German Rexroth
Main motor speed reducer German Rexroth
Tail bracket hoisting motor American Eton
Hydraulic meter German

Frequently Asked Questions
What is the maximum pulling capacity of the 40KN hydraulic cable puller?
The puller can exert up to 40 kilonewtons (KN) of force, making it ideal for heavy-duty cables in overhead stringing projects like high-voltage transmission lines.
Can this cable puller be used for all types of cables?
Yes, it's versatile for power cables, telecommunications cables, fiber optics, and more, as long as the cable is within the pulling capacity range.
How do I operate the hydraulic cable puller?
The puller includes controls for adjusting force, direction, and speed. Engage the hydraulic system via the control valve for smooth operation, following manufacturer guidelines.
Is the puller suitable for outdoor conditions?
Yes, its durable construction withstands harsh weather including rain, dust, and high temperatures.
Can I use this for underground cable installations?
While primarily for overhead projects, it can be used underground with proper cable rollers to guide cables into trenches.
How do I prevent cable damage during pulling?
Use adjustable tension control for proper force application and ensure proper cable alignment along the puller's path.
What maintenance does the puller require?
Regularly check hydraulic fluid levels, inspect hoses/fittings for leaks, ensure smooth operation, and clean after exposure to harsh conditions.
Is the hydraulic cable puller portable?
Yes, its compact design allows easy transportation between job sites, operable by small teams without heavy equipment.
Operation Guide
  1. Preparation: Inspect puller condition, check hydraulic connections and oil levels, and securely attach cable to gripper system.
  2. Setup: Position puller at cable run start, align along path, and set desired pulling force with tension control.
  3. Cable Pulling: Start hydraulic pump, apply gradual force, monitor for strain, and adjust tension as needed.
  4. Completion: Stop system, lock puller, disconnect cable, and inspect installation for damage.
